3196.0. "%MCC-E-INSEVTPOOLMEM" by MICROW::LANG () Wed Jun 17 1992 13:15

    
    	We are running 2 AM's with MCC EFT update, on Ultrix.  After
    	about 250 iterations of making management requests, both
    	AM's get the following:  
    
    
    Failure in kernel event receipt. Thread terminating
     %MCC-E-INSEVTPOOLMEM, insufficient event pool memory to post event
    
    	We must be running out of a resource, but I couldn't tell from
    	the installation notes, or the installation on Ultrix, what we
    	were running out of.  Can someone provide more insight?
    
    	When are these events being posted? Can we disable the posting?
    
    
    	The swap space is as follows:
    rock2.tay1.dec.com> /etc/pstat -s
    184312k swap configured
    70796k reserved virtual address space
            31732k used (9408k text, 1376k smem)
            152580k free, 968k wasted, 0k missingDECmcc (T1.2.7)

3196.1Install guide?TOOK::MINTZErik Mintz, dtn 226-5033Wed Jun 17 1992 18:127
Did you follow the installation guide instructions for reconfiguring
shared memory and semaphores on the system (and rebuild the
ULTRIX kernel after making the adjustments?)

3196.4UpgradeTOOK::MINTZErik Mintz, dtn 226-5033Thu Aug 06 1992 15:295
There have been a number of fixes to the event handling code since
T1.2.7.  I would suggest that you upgrade to the SSB kit.
